The following message appears when the GF1 Panel is started: "Warning Kernel. 346520: Error initializing IDE Drive C:" The message appears several times. The project can no longer be started.
This problem occurs if the PCMCIA card was formatted under Windows XP. Windows XP used a type of formatting (Big DOS FAT) that is not supported by the GF-1 Panel. Contact Support if you wish to reformat cards correctly that were formatted in Windows XP.
Correct procedure when using Galileo up to version 4.20.x in Windows XP for GF1 Panels:
Do not format the PCMCIA card and carry out the project download using a serial download.

The following error message appears when the project is opened: Module 'root...' not found.
Cause
:
A project was opened with an unknown target system. The target system configured in the project is not installed on the programming PC.
Solution
:
Install the appropriate target system on the programming PC before opening the project
or:
Open the project and ignore the error messages => The PLC configuration is removed from the project. The required target system must then be selected in the Target Settings menu and the standard configuration must be added in the PLC configuration.

The following error messages occur during compiling: MAX_MASTERINDEX unknown.
Cause
:
Faulty PLC configuration: CAN libraries are added to the project in the Library Manager, however, the PLC configuration does not have the CanMaster.
Solution
:
Add the CanMaster to the PLC configuration using "Insert element".

The following error messages occur during compiling: MAX_NetVarPDO_Tx_CAN not declared, MAX_NetVarPDO_Rx_CAN not declared
Cause
:
In the Target Settings menu, the 'Support network variables' or 'CAN network interface' option was removed in the Network functionality tab. The library 3S_CANOPENNETVAR.lib is not automatically removed from the project in the Library Manager.
Solution
:
In the Library Manager, remove the library 3S_CANOPENNETVAR.lib manually from the project.

Error messages are appearing for such a short time that they can hardly be read. What can be done to prevent this?
From Galileo Version 5.2.x the error message can be stopped by touching the screen with your finger. The bar is visible as long as it is "held" with your finger.
Alternatively, it is also possible to set how long the error bar is to appear. In the Runtime folder of the compiled project, the file grs_log."language" must be opened with an editor. The display time can be set here in seconds (standard 2, maximum 9)
